Eight: A Modern Display Font for Eye-Catching Branding

Eight is a bold, contemporary outline block display font that brings energy and clarity to any visual project. Its clean lines and structured form make it ideal for creating attention-grabbing headlines, promotional banners, and brand-centric designs. Whether you're designing a social media post or a digital ad, Eight delivers a strong visual impact without sacrificing readability.

Visual Style and Personality of Eight

The design of Eight is minimalist yet expressive. Each letter is crafted with sharp edges and a balanced structure, giving it a modern, professional feel. This font radiates confidence and approachability, making it perfect for brands aiming to communicate authority and freshness simultaneously.

Its outline style adds depth and dimension, allowing it to stand out on both dark and light backgrounds. This versatility ensures that Eight can be used across various platforms while maintaining its visual appeal and legibility.

Practical Font Pairing and Design Tips

To maximize the impact of Eight, consider pairing it with a complementary font that balances its boldness. A clean sans serif font is ideal for captions or body text, while a serif font can add a more refined or editorial tone to your designs.

For decorative accents, use Eight sparingly—perhaps in logo marks, taglines, or as a highlight in infographics. Avoid overusing it in long paragraphs, as this can reduce readability and distract from the message.

Always ensure that the font size is appropriate for the medium. On small previews or thumbnails, keep the text concise and avoid complex shapes that might not render well at smaller sizes.
